Welcome to our forum and don't do anything just yet.

You are probably not on sufficient medication but in order for us to support/help you I would make a new appointment for a blood test. Ask for a Full Thyroid Function Test (they may not all be done but ask anyway). Tell your GP you want TSH, T4, T3, Free T4 and Free T3, iron, ferritin and folate plus Vit B12, Vit D. too.

Tell him you're fed up always being unwell and now is the time you are going to take a hand in your own health.

Make and appointment for the earliest time and fast. Do not take levo for approx 24 hours before the blood test and take it afterwards.

Get a print-out of your blood test results with the ranges and post them on a new question for comments.

If he says he wont request Free T3 tell him you need to know if you are converting levo to sufficient T3 as it is the active hormone needed in ALL of your receptor cells in your body. Without sufficient we cannot function properly. Don't forget a gap of 24 hours approx from levo and your blood test. You can always get a private test if necessary.
